About Qingwei Zhong
Qingwei Zhong is a scholar working on Industrial and Manufacturing Engineering, Mechanical Engineering, Transportation, Aerospace Engineering and Automotive Engineering, having authored 29 papers that have together received 288 indexed citations. Recurring topics across this work include Railway Systems and Energy Efficiency (11 papers), Railway Engineering and Dynamics (8 papers), Transportation Planning and Optimization (7 papers), Air Traffic Management and Optimization (4 papers), Multi-Criteria Decision Making (3 papers), Robotic Path Planning Algorithms (3 papers), Maritime Ports and Logistics (3 papers) and Risk and Safety Analysis (2 papers). The work is most often cited by research in Transportation (132 citations), Industrial and Manufacturing Engineering (168 citations), Building and Construction (57 citations), Automotive Engineering (32 citations) and Environmental Engineering (37 citations). Qingwei Zhong has collaborated with scholars based in China, United States and Macao. Frequent co-authors include Qiyuan Peng, Yongxiang Zhang, Jesper Larsen, Richard Martin Lusby, Cheolhee Yoo, Qihao Weng, Huijuan Xiao, Siqi Jia, Xuesong Zhou and Gongyuan Lu. Their work appears in journals such as Journal of Advanced Transportation, International Journal of Computational Intelligence Systems, Transportation Research Part B Methodological, Chinese Journal of Aeronautics and International Journal of Rail Transportation.
